Role overview
We currently have an exciting opportunity for a Personal Assistant to join Oldham Council.

If successful you will provide a proactive and comprehensive Executive Support Service to the Senior Management Team across the organisation.


Key responsibilities

Key Requirements
To succeed in this role you will need as a minimum:

  • Experience of providing secretarial/PA support to a Senior Manager/Director or similar role within an organisation and you will be entirely confident using technology. Above all, going the extra mile to deliver an impeccable level of service will be second nature to you.
  • Outstanding communication skills (written and oral), ability to work to competing and tight deadlines and an insatiable appetite for work planning, prioritising and highly developed organisation.
  • Experience of working within a team. You must be able to work at pace with attention to detail, with the ability to multitask and switch between a number of conflicting priorities. You will be able to work on your own initiative as well as playing a critical role in an important team. You will be a loyal individual who upholds a high level of confidentiality.
